Не работает "Маркет Дополнений"

Проблемы/вопросы, связанные с запуском под различными платформами и конфигурациями.

Модератор: immortal

pavelt
Сообщения: 43
Зарегистрирован: Ср июн 10, 2015 10:46 pm
Благодарил (а): 0
Поблагодарили: 6 раз

Re: Не работает

Сообщение pavelt » Пн дек 11, 2017 11:59 am

ngservis писал(а):Доступность маркета проверь со своей сети .

Отправлено с моего X5max_PRO через Tapatalk
Первое что сделал. Ошибка с кодом 500 валиться в районе вызова метода echonow маркета
pavelt
Сообщения: 43
Зарегистрирован: Ср июн 10, 2015 10:46 pm
Благодарил (а): 0
Поблагодарили: 6 раз

Re: Не работает

Сообщение pavelt » Ср дек 13, 2017 10:35 am

pavelt писал(а):
ngservis писал(а):Доступность маркета проверь со своей сети .

Отправлено с моего X5max_PRO через Tapatalk
Первое что сделал. Ошибка с кодом 500 валиться в районе вызова метода echonow маркета

Проблему решил тем, что ссылку на CONNECT исправил на https, а в коде было http. Соответственно, вместо списка модулей отдавалась сообщение о перемещении сайта, что приводило к падению скрипта, т.к. вместо JSON формата были левые данные
За это сообщение автора pavelt поблагодарил:
cergant (Чт дек 14, 2017 4:26 pm)
Рейтинг: 1.16%
cergant
Сообщения: 2
Зарегистрирован: Чт дек 14, 2017 8:05 am
Благодарил (а): 1 раз
Поблагодарили: 0

Re: Не работает

Сообщение cergant » Чт дек 14, 2017 4:00 pm

pavelt писал(а):
pavelt писал(а):
ngservis писал(а):Доступность маркета проверь со своей сети .

Отправлено с моего X5max_PRO через Tapatalk
Первое что сделал. Ошибка с кодом 500 валиться в районе вызова метода echonow маркета

Проблему решил тем, что ссылку на CONNECT исправил на https, а в коде было http. Соответственно, вместо списка модулей отдавалась сообщение о перемещении сайта, что приводило к падению скрипта, т.к. вместо JSON формата были левые данные
сделал то же самое, маркет появился, но ничего не устанавливается, при нажатии Добавить, скачивается, потом 4 зеленых OK страница обновляется и ничего.
Monte
Сообщения: 3
Зарегистрирован: Пн ноя 20, 2017 7:04 pm
Благодарил (а): 0
Поблагодарили: 0

Re: Не работает

Сообщение Monte » Вт дек 19, 2017 5:38 pm

cergant писал(а):Проблему решил тем, что ссылку на CONNECT исправил на https, а в коде было http.
сделал то же самое, маркет появился, но ничего не устанавливается, при нажатии Добавить, скачивается, потом 4 зеленых OK страница обновляется и ничего.
Не помогло ...
в /var/www/modules/market/market.class.php (200)
исправил

Код: Выделить всё

//$result=getURL($data_url, 120);
$result=file_get_contents($data_url);
функция getURL перенакрученная курлом у которого еще и DNS не резолвится... единственное что в ней полезно так это cach
но Да... одной заменой здесь не обойдешся... во всех других местах вызывется то именно она...

определена она в /var/www/lib/common.class.php(764) у себя исправил так

Код: Выделить всё

      if (!$username && !$password && !$background )  $result = file_get_contents($url);
      else
      {
        try
        {         
              // ... старый вызов curl     
        }
        catch (Exception $e)
        {
             registerError('geturl', $url . ' ' . get_class($e) . ', ' . $e->getMessage());
        }  
      }
Monte
Сообщения: 3
Зарегистрирован: Пн ноя 20, 2017 7:04 pm
Благодарил (а): 0
Поблагодарили: 0

Re: Не работает "Маркет Дополнений"

Сообщение Monte » Пн дек 25, 2017 4:36 pm

Еще маленько повозился и увидел что домен не резолвится из за нескольких redirect
и у меня например на каждый уходит по 6 сек.
т.е. если урл начинается с http то 12 сек ждем
а если с https то 6 сек
интересно что сам json грузится практически мгновенно и после исправления
/var/www/lib/common.class.php(782)

Код: Выделить всё

curl_setopt($ch, CURLOPT_CONNECTTIMEOUT, 20); //  раньше было 5
curl_setopt($ch, CURLOPT_MAXREDIRS, 10); // раньше было 2     
все заработало...
ДУМАЮ ПО ПРАВИЛЬНОМУ... ВЫНЕСТИ ЭТИ НАСТРОЙКИ В config.php УВАЖАЕМЫЕ ВЕДУЩИЕ ПРОЕКТА!!! Учтите это плз... чтобы после обновления каждый раз не править эти файлы
ngservis
Сообщения: 92
Зарегистрирован: Ср ноя 19, 2014 4:15 pm
Откуда: Альметьевск
Благодарил (а): 7 раз
Поблагодарили: 4 раза

Re: Не работает "Маркет Дополнений"

Сообщение ngservis » Пн янв 01, 2018 8:51 pm

А если вдруг скорость до узла упадёт , на сколько эти данные изменять значения ?

Отправлено с моего X5max_PRO через Tapatalk
Rasberry PI + arduino mega 2560
welcomtowel
Сообщения: 1
Зарегистрирован: Вс янв 07, 2018 7:32 pm
Благодарил (а): 0
Поблагодарили: 0

Re: Не работает "Маркет Дополнений"

Сообщение welcomtowel » Вс янв 07, 2018 7:57 pm

Здравствуйте, столкнулся с проблемой, что не могу достучаться до маркета. Чистая установка из образа на Pi3.
Обновлял 100 раз уже... Я в отчаянии.
В логах:
19:24:59 0.84689200 GetURL to http://connect.smartliving.ru/market/?l ... NU%2FLinux (source admin) finished with error: Resolving timed out after 5514 milliseconds {"url":"http:\/\/connect.smartliving.ru\/market\/?lang=ru&serial=289e0434&locale=ru-RU%2Cru%3Bq%3D0.9%2Cen-US%3Bq%3D0.8%2Cen%3Bq%3D0.7&os=Linux+majordomo+4.9.59-v7%2B+%231047+SMP+Sun+Oct+29+12%3A19%3A23+GMT+2017+armv7l+GNU%2FLinux","content_type":null,"http_code":0,"header_size":0,"request_size":0,"filetime":-1,"ssl_verify_result":0,"redirect_count":0,"total_time":5.513797,"namelookup_time":0,"connect_time":0,"pretransfer_time":0,"size_upload":0,"size_download":0,"speed_download":0,"speed_upload":0,"download_content_length":-1,"upload_content_length":-1,"starttransfer_time":0,"redirect_time":0,"redirect_url":"","primary_ip":"","certinfo":[],"primary_port":0,"local_ip":"","local_port":0}
biba
Сообщения: 2
Зарегистрирован: Вт янв 16, 2018 4:27 pm
Благодарил (а): 0
Поблагодарили: 0

Re: Не работает "Маркет Дополнений"

Сообщение biba » Вт янв 16, 2018 4:29 pm

Добрый день все. Таже проблема((( ставил вчера все прошло хорошо, все запустилось но маркет не доступен, только конпка обновить
biba
Сообщения: 2
Зарегистрирован: Вт янв 16, 2018 4:27 pm
Благодарил (а): 0
Поблагодарили: 0

Re: Не работает "Маркет Дополнений"

Сообщение biba » Вт янв 16, 2018 4:59 pm

welcomtowel а интернет соединение есть) я тупанул) настройки сети сделал не верно и не было интернета, поэтому соответсвенно и маркета)
alkaloidus
Сообщения: 4
Зарегистрирован: Вс янв 04, 2015 3:32 pm
Благодарил (а): 0
Поблагодарили: 0

Re: Не работает "Маркет Дополнений"

Сообщение alkaloidus » Сб фев 24, 2018 3:12 pm

Подскажите пожалуйста куда копать, установил на win10prox64, сразу после установки пытаюсь добавить плагин из маркета кнопкой внизу и получаю следующее:
Downloading 'https://github.com/sergejey/majordomo-m ... ter.tar.gz' ... OK
Unpacking 'mqtt.tgz' .. ERROR
Removing dir C:\_majordomo\htdocs/saverestore/temp ... OK

Причем если нажать добавить справа от плагина получаю :
Downloading 'http://connect.smartliving.ru/market/?o ... =9e6e-e342' ... OK
Removing dir C:\_majordomo\htdocs/saverestore/temp ... OK
Unpacking 'mqtt.tgz' ... OK
Updating files ... OK
Plugin 'mqtt' (2018-02-05 22:57:21) installed.
Redirecting to main page...

А в проверке обновлений плагин появляется:
mqtt.tgz 0.00 Mb

но в устройствах его нет.
Ответить